# File 'lib/rubylisp/macro.rb', line 7

def compute_required_argument_count(args)
  a = args
  @required_argument_count = 0
  @var_args = false
  while a
    if a.symbol?
      @var_args = true
      return
    else
      @required_argument_count += 1
    end
    a = a.cdr
  end
end

# File 'lib/rubylisp/macro.rb', line 34

def expand(parameters, env, should_eval)
  if @var_args
    raise "#{@name} expected at least #{@required_argument_count} parameters, received #{parameters.length}." if parameters.length < @required_argument_count
  else
    raise "#{@name} expected #{@required_argument_count} parameters, received #{parameters.length}." unless parameters.length == @required_argument_count        
  end
  
  local_env = EnvironmentFrame.extending(@env, env.frame)
  self_sym = Symbol.named("self")
  if env.frame
    local_env.bind_locally(self_sym, env.frame)
  elsif env.local_binding_for(self_sym)
    local_env.bind_locally(self_sym, env.value_of(self_sym))
  end
  arg = @arguments
  param = parameters
  accumulating_arg = nil
  accumulated_params = []
  while !param.nil?        
    param_value = should_eval ? param.car.evaluate(env) : param.car
    if accumulating_arg
      accumulated_params << param_value
    else
      local_env.bind_locally(arg.car, param_value) unless arg.car.nil?
    end
    param = param.cdr
    arg = arg.cdr unless accumulating_arg
    accumulating_arg = arg if arg.symbol?
  end
  local_env.bind_locally(accumulating_arg, Lisp::ConsCell.array_to_list(accumulated_params)) if accumulating_arg
  
  @body.evaluate(local_env)
end
